I try to send a snmp trap to my system, the example as follows,
snmptrap -v 1 -c public 192.168.3.45 .1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.30 CISCO-13000 6
3540 15 \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.100.10.20.1 s "20080227205807S"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.80.4103.220 s "90"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.20.4103.220 s "670"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.60.4103.220 s "16386"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.30.4103.220 s "4"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.40.4103.220 s "10"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.50.4103.220 s "0" \
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3607.6.10.20.30.20.1.100.4103.220 s "testFAC-3-4"
And I check the log
#tail -f /var/log/snmptt/snmptt.log
But it's didn't shown in the log
Can anyone tell me what is wrong with the trap?
